数据库系统包含数据库和什么
-
数据库系统包含数据库和数据库管理系统(DBMS)。
数据库是指存储、组织和管理数据的集合。它是一个结构化的数据集合,可以以表格的形式组织数据,并通过行和列的交叉点存储数据。数据库可以存储多种类型的数据,例如文本、图像、音频和视频等。
数据库管理系统(DBMS)是指用于管理数据库的软件系统。它提供了一系列的工具和功能,用于创建、操作、管理和维护数据库。DBMS可以管理数据库的结构和内容,并提供了数据的安全性、完整性和一致性等功能。
DBMS可以分为关系型数据库管理系统(RDBMS)和非关系型数据库管理系统(NoSQL DBMS)两种类型。
关系型数据库管理系统(RDBMS)采用表格的形式组织数据,使用结构化查询语言(SQL)进行数据操作和查询。常见的关系型数据库管理系统包括Oracle、MySQL和Microsoft SQL Server等。
非关系型数据库管理系统(NoSQL DBMS)则不使用表格的形式组织数据,而是使用其他的数据模型,例如键值对、文档、列族和图等。NoSQL DBMS在处理大规模、非结构化和分布式数据方面具有优势。常见的NoSQL DBMS包括MongoDB、Cassandra和Redis等。
总之,数据库系统包含数据库和数据库管理系统,它们一起提供了数据的存储、管理和操作功能,是现代信息系统中不可或缺的组成部分。
1年前 -
数据库系统包含数据库和数据库管理系统(DBMS)。
-
数据库:数据库是指存储有组织的数据的集合。它是一个结构化的文件集合,用于存储和管理数据。数据库可以包含各种类型的数据,如文本、数字、图像、音频和视频等。
-
数据库管理系统(DBMS):数据库管理系统是一种软件工具,用于管理数据库。它提供了一套功能和工具,用于创建、操作和管理数据库。DBMS负责处理数据库的安全性、完整性、备份和恢复等任务。
-
数据:数据库系统的核心是数据。数据是指描述现实世界中事物和事件的事实或信息。数据库系统可以存储和管理大量的数据,并提供各种查询和操作方式。
-
数据库模式:数据库模式定义了数据库的结构和组织方式。它包含了数据库中所有表、字段、关系和约束等的定义。数据库模式定义了数据的逻辑结构,使得用户可以根据其需求来访问和操作数据。
-
数据库操作语言(DML):数据库操作语言是用于操作数据库中数据的语言。它包括插入、删除、更新和查询等操作。DML提供了一组命令和语法,使用户可以对数据库中的数据进行增删改查操作。
1年前 -
-
数据库系统包括数据库和数据库管理系统(DBMS)。
数据库是指一组相关数据的集合,这些数据以一种结构化的方式进行组织、存储和管理,以便于访问、操作和更新。数据库可以存储各种类型的数据,包括文本、数字、图像、音频和视频等。
数据库管理系统(DBMS)是一个软件应用程序,用于管理数据库。它提供了一组工具和功能,使用户能够创建、访问、操作和维护数据库。DBMS负责处理数据库中的数据,确保数据的完整性、一致性和安全性。它还提供了一种机制,使用户能够通过SQL(结构化查询语言)或其他查询语言来检索和操作数据库中的数据。
数据库系统的主要组成部分包括以下几个方面:
-
数据库模型:数据库模型定义了数据在数据库中的组织方式和结构。常见的数据库模型包括层次模型、网络模型、关系模型和面向对象模型。
-
数据库设计:数据库设计是指根据应用程序的需求,确定数据库的结构和组织方式。它包括确定实体、属性和关系,并设计适当的数据表和表之间的关系。
-
数据库语言:数据库语言是用于定义、查询和操作数据库的语言。最常见的数据库语言是SQL,它可以用于创建表、插入数据、更新数据和删除数据等操作。
-
数据库操作:数据库操作是指对数据库进行查询、插入、更新和删除等操作。用户可以使用数据库操作来检索特定的数据,更新数据或执行复杂的数据操作。
-
数据库管理:数据库管理是指对数据库进行管理和维护的活动。它包括备份和恢复数据库、优化数据库性能、监视数据库运行状态和管理数据库用户权限等。
总结起来,数据库系统包括数据库和数据库管理系统,用于存储、管理和操作数据。数据库系统的设计和使用需要考虑数据模型、数据库设计、数据库语言和数据库操作等方面的因素。
1年前 -